A garage door seal is the rubber or vinyl stripping that runs along the bottom and sides of your door to keep out drafts, moisture, and pests. What causes garage door sensor alignment issues?

Garage door sensor alignment issues often occur when the sensors are bumped or obstructed. Dirt or debris on the sensor lenses can also interfere with the signal. What are the options for garage door opener replacement?

Garage door opener replacement offers various options, including chain drive, belt drive, and wall mount models. Chain drives are robust, belt drives are quieter, and wall mounts save ceiling space. What's involved in garage door bottom seal replacement?

Garage door bottom seal replacement involves removing the old, worn-out seal and installing a new one. This seal prevents water, debris, and pests from entering your garage.
